~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~Safe House~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
Sonny walked into the bare room where Alcazar was being held. His face was a stone mask, something he'd learned from Jason. But he was not indifferent to the man chained to a chair before him he hated him.
"I was wondering when you'd show up. So this is it? I'm going to die? What will Carly think of that?" Alcazar asked, playing on Sonny's attachment to his wife, his only protection.
Sonny smiled, "I don't give a flying fuck what Carly will think. In case you hadn't heard, we're divorced. And yes, this is it you are going to die. I'm done playing games with you, and there's nothing stopping me."
"Well, I suppose Jason is excited about this."
"Jason's not here. This is between you and me. Johnny!" Sonny yelled for his man. Johnny scurried in handing Sonny his gun. "Go to hell Alcazar." Were his last words before aiming at Alcazar and pulling the trigger, leaving a bullet right between his eyes. "Clean up this mess." He ordered Johnny before walking out of the room and standing in front of the door across the hall.
Sonny sighed as he felt the weights on his shoulders settle in. This was what he was really dreading. Dealing with Alcazar was easy, but this was different. He couldn't very well kill his sister. He didn't bother knocking before turning the knob and entering the room.
Courtney was a mess. Her clothes were disheveled, her hair was all over the place and she was pacing. She didn't like being trapped. She knew she was in trouble, but she also knew Sonny wouldn't kill her. As he entered the room her anger grew.
"Let's get this over with O.K.? You're pissed off. Fine. I don't really care. You're not going to kill me and I'm not going to apologize so let me go and we'll all go about our business." Courtney said, folding her arms over her chest and staring at Sonny defiantly.
"Shut up!" Sonny's angry voice stunned Courtney. "Sit." She sat. "I don't know what happened with you, frankly I don't care. Apparently all my siblings hate me and that's just fine. You're no better than Rick." Courtney seethed at that. "The difference is while he was a worthy adversary you're nothing more than a spoiled little brat. You're right, I'm not going to kill you, but I'm not letting you go. You're moving away from here. I'm sending guard with you to keep an eye on you. You'll stay away from my family and me. Don't cross me again." Sonny said turning to leave.
"Do you really think it's that easy? I'm not like everyone else in this fucked up town. I don't bow down before the mighty Sonny Corinthos. You can order me around all you want but I'm not going anywhere!" She screamed.
"Don't piss me off you stupid little bitch." He said before closing the door.
